Superstitious, magical, and paranormal beliefs: An integrative model

Marjaana Lindeman ¤, Kia Aarnio

Department of Psychology, University of Helsinki, Finland

Available online 4 August 2006

Abstract

Lack of conceptual clarity has hampered theory formation and research on superstitious, mag-ical, and paranormal beliefs. This study oVers a conceptual framework where these concepts arediVerentiated from other unfounded beliefs and deWned identically as a confusion of core knowl-edge about physical, psychological, and biological phenomena. When testing this deWnition withquestionnaire items (N D 239), the results showed that superstitious individuals accepted more vio-lations of core ontological distinctions than skeptics did and that ontological confusions discrimi-nated believers from skeptics better than intuitive thinking, analytical thinking, or emotionalinstability. The Wndings justify the present conceptualization of superstitious, magical, and para-normal beliefs, and oVer new theoretical propositions for the familiar everyday beliefs that are yetscientiWcally so poorly understood.© 2006 Elsevier Inc. All rights reserved.

Keywords: Superstition; Magical thinking; Paranormal beliefs; Intuitive thinking; Core knowledge

1. Introduction

More than 40% of American people believe in devils, ghosts, and spiritual healing(National Science Foundation, 2002; Rice, 2003). Researchers, in turn, have characterizedsuperstitious and magical thinking as an extremely discouraging research topic (Scheibe &Sarbin, 1965), a problem for which there is no ready solution (Campbell, 1996), and as

“a label for a residual category—a garbage bin Wlled with various odds and ends that wedo not otherwise know what to do with” (NemeroV & Rozin, 2000, p. 1).

Superstitious and magical beliefs have certainly been examined, and a body of researchhas identiWed numerous correlates for them, ranging from personality traits, motivation,and cognition to emotional instability, demographics, and social inXuences (reviews: Vyse,1997; Zusne & Jones, 1989). Despite the accumulating information, however, the overallpicture of superstition is unclear and remains to be adequately described and explained.

We suggest that a lack of conceptual clarity has hampered theoretical progress. Becausethere is no agreement about what the domain entails, theoretically important assumptionshave been diYcult to make. Most importantly, whether and how the constructs supersti-tion, magical beliefs, and paranormal (supernatural) beliefs diVer from each other, andabove all, how they diVer from other groundless beliefs (e.g., “whales are Wsh”), is notknown. Consequently, there is a strong need for a conceptual model that clariWes the mean-ing of magical, paranormal, and superstitious beliefs, and explains why well-educatedWestern people still believe in things that seem so irrational. The present study provides aninitial step in this direction. Our aim was to oVer new theoretical propositions, which serveto deWne the constructs and oVer criteria for their application, and to analyze whether thedeWnition can be empirically justiWed.

Very often, the deWnition of superstition, magical, or paranormal belief is either omittedor substituted by examples of such beliefs. Nonetheless, some deWnitions can be found incurrent scientiWc literature. Among the most inXuential deWnitions of magical thinking arethe laws of sympathetic magic (Frazer, 1922/1963; Tylor, 1871/1974). The law of contagionholds that things that have once been in contact with each other continue to act upon eachother at a distance after the physical contact has been severed. The law of similarity holdsthat superWcial resemblance indicates, or causes, deep resemblance. During the last twodecades, Rozin and NemeroV have conducted a series of path-breaking studies and showedhow the same laws manifest themselves among well-educated Western adults, for example,as reluctance to wear Hitler’s sweater (NemeroV & Rozin, 2000; Rozin, Millman, &NemeroV, 1986). However, the laws of sympathetic magic are neither intended nor suY-cient to cover all superstitious, magical, and paranormal beliefs. Moreover, as the research-ers themselves note, the distinction between the laws of magical thinking and reality, forexample, between magical contagion and microbial contamination and between magicalsimilarity and vaccination, is subtle and ambiguous (Frazer, 1922/1963; NemeroV & Rozin,2000).

Other authors have deWned superstitious and magical beliefs more widely as false cogni-tions, for example, as limitations in cognitive processing (Shweder, 1977), beliefs that arebarely articulated (Campbell, 1996), tenets founded on ignorance (Padgett & Jorgenson,1982), and as causal beliefs that by conventional standards are invalid (Brugger & Graves,1997). Undeniably, deWning the beliefs as erroneous covers all superstitions and magicalbeliefs as diverse they may be. But the important question still remains: how do they diVerfrom other unfounded beliefs?

A concept that might stand for this diVerence is paranormality. Many researchers haveadopted Broad’s (1953) conceptualization of paranormality as a phenomenon that violatesthe fundamental and scientiWcally founded principles of nature. In our view, the deWningproperty, and the core that diVerentiates superstitious, magical, and paranormal beliefsfrom other unfounded beliefs, can be better derived from recent studies on children’s cog-nitive development.

1.1. Core knowledge and superstition

According to developmental psychologists, there are three major sorts of knowledgethat determine children’s understanding of the world: intuitive physics, intuitive psychol-ogy, and with certain reservations, intuitive biology (Goswami, 2002; Wellman & Gelman,1992, 1998). Part of this knowledge can be characterized as core knowledge in that childrenlearn it without instruction, it provides a basis for further development, and it is based ondomain specialized learning mechanisms (modules) about ecologically important entitiesand events (Carey, 1996; Leslie, 1994; Spelke, 2000). The vast majority of core knowledgedevelops by preschool age and it encompasses an intuitive comprehension of physical, bio-logical, and psychological entities as well as diVerent forms of processes these entitiesengage in.

Developmental studies show that core knowledge of physical entities includes thenotion that the world is composed of material objects, which have volume and an indepen-dent existence in space (reviews: Carey & Spelke, 1994; Spelke, 2000; Wellman & Gelman,1992, 1998). The core of intuitive knowledge about psychological entities, in turn, consistsof knowledge that animate beings are intentional agents who have a mind. By the middleof the second year children understand that animate beings can reciprocate actions andhave a capacity to move and initiate actions without external force (Carey & Spelke, 1994;Rakison & Poulin-Dubois, 2001; Wellman & Gelman, 1992). In addition, small childrenunderstand that the contents of mind, such as thoughts, beliefs, desires, and symbols, arenot substantial and objective but non-material and mental, and that they do not have theproperties they stand for (Johnson, 2000; Leslie, Friedman, & German, 2004; Piaget, 1929/1951; Wellman, 2002; Wellman & Gelman, 1998). For example, 3- and 4-year-old childrenunderstand that the thought of a dog does not have the material properties of a dog (Har-ris, Brown, Marriot, Whithall, & Harmer, 1991) and that the roads in a map do not need tobe wide enough for cars (DeLoache, 2002).

As regards biological phenomena, it seems that at least notions like contamination andhealing can be characterized as core knowledge (Wellman & Gelman, 1992). They repre-sent a species-typical adaptation to the problem of food selection and rejection as well asillness avoidance (Rozin, 1990; Rozin & Fallon, 1987), and cultures that lack scientiWcunderstanding of disease transmission understand it intuitively (Kalish, 1999). Similarly, 4-year-olds know that abnormal behaviors are not contagious (Keil, 1994) and they can dis-criminate between contaminated and safe substances despite lack of visible evidence (Fal-lon, Rozin, & Pliner, 1984).

In addition, children learn early to honor the distinctions of diVerent types of processeswhich physical, biological, and psychological entities are engaged in. Small children under-stand that material objects like balls can aVect one another’s motion only if they touch(Carey & Spelke, 1994; Wellman & Gelman, 1992), and they believe that physical eventstake place because an entity gives force (energy, power) to another entity (Leslie, 1994;Wang, Kaufman, & Baillargeon, 2003). In turn, already young infants understand people’sactions to result from intentions, and by the age of four, children have learned to giveintentional explanations for people’s actions and non-intentional explanations for physicalprocesses like gravitation and for biological processes such as how plants get their coloring(Malle, 1997; Schult & Wellman, 1997; Springer & Keil, 1991; Wellman & Gelman, 1998).

The same ideas that shape children’s intuitive knowledge about the distinctiveproperties of the three ontological categories can be found in superstitions. However, in

superstitions the properties are not limited to one domain but conXated with each otherand applied across categories. As a consequence, amazing entities and processes withextraordinary properties come into existence.

The fusion renders possible, among others, mental contents that have the attributes ofphysical or animate entities, resulting in the possibility that a thought can touch objects(psychokinesis) and move by itself (telepathy). Similarly, when contagion and healing areattributed to psychological phenomena we Wnd that Hitler’s personality can spread into hissweater (NemeroV, 1995; Rozin et al., 1986) and that a curer can heal someone at a dis-tance by force of his or her thoughts. Also, in this other world, entire good and bad minds,such as angels and devils, have independent existences and operate as animate entities bymoving and initiating actions without external force. Also symbolic representations andthe material objects they represent are confused in magical thinking, as Piaget (1929/1951)observed. Hence, symbols are assumed to have the same attributes as the material thingsthey signify, leading to such phenomena as reluctance to drink from a cyanide-labeled bot-tle known to include only sucrose–water (Rozin et al., 1986), or beliefs that a physicalobject (e.g., foot of a rabbit) that someone has intended to stand for an emotion (e.g., hap-piness) actually carries happiness in its train.

In the magical world, we also Wnd non-intentional physical and biological events turninginto intentional ones. Intention may be seen to inXuence natural or random events such as incases of rainmaking rites and modern craps players who roll the dice gently to coax a lownumber and more vigorously to encourage a high number (a review: Vyse, 1997). Moreover,in superstitions a force is an equally important factor as in lay physics but here force isregarded as a living and intentional entity. For example, feng shui teaches us that erroneousfurnishings may absorb vital (lat.D life) force that leads us to crimes and divorce, and astrol-ogers suggest that planets have living energy, which pushes and pulls on human beings in apurposeful way thus aVecting our personality and well-being. Thus, in superstitious thinkingbiological and physical processes are no longer non-intentional but they are seen as having apurpose, that is, as directed toward certain goals and as being intentionally caused either by aspeciWc or an unspeciWed intentional agent (Bering, 2003; Kelemen, 1999a).

The above argumentation implies that, despite diVerences in focus, the notions of super-stition, magical thinking, and paranormal beliefs share the same ontological confusion andcan thus be regarded synonymous. If properties of one ontological category are borrowedto characterize an entity in another ontological category, the following statement is notmerely a falsehood but it is a category mistake (Carey, 1985; Chi, 1992; Keil, 1979, 1994).Accordingly, we deWne superstitious, magical, and paranormal beliefs as category mistakeswhere the core attributes of mental, physical, and biological entities and processes are con-fused with each other.

However, all category mistakes are not superstitions. For example, many adults regardphysical force as a material substance (Reiner, Slotta, Chi, & Resnick, 2000), which it isnot. What diVerentiates other category mistakes from superstitions is that in superstitionsthe category mistakes always include a confusion of core knowledge, and perhaps thereforelay people seem to recognize some beliefs as false beliefs and others as superstitions quiteeasily and implicitly.

Second, category mistakes can be perceived as superstitions only insofar as the state-ments are believed to be literally true. Thus, metaphorical and allegorical expressions thatdeliberately confuse the properties are not superstitions (e.g., “A well-functioning memoryis a goldmine”).

While preschool children understand surprisingly much about physical, biological, andpsychological phenomena, they nevertheless make at Wrst the same category mistakes thatcan be found in superstitions (Kelemen, 1999a, 1999b; Rosengren, Johnson, & Harris,2000). However, equating adults’ superstitions with small children’s misconceptions doesnot imply that superstitious individuals are cognitively at the level of small children. ThedeWnition should be understood through the basic tenet of dual-process theories that peo-ple have two modes of processing information, intuitive and analytical reasoning, whichrely on diVerent databases and have diVerent rules of operation (Evans, 2003; Pacini &Epstein, 1999; Sloman, 1996; Stanovich & West, 2000; Sun, 2004). According to the dual-process theories, analytical processes and rational knowledge do not replace intuitive pro-cesses and contents as children mature. Rather, both types of processes and knowledgeexist and develop throughout one’s life, and therefore two conXicting beliefs can coexist inan adult’s mind, one more rational and verbally justiWable (e.g. “Death is Wnal”), the otheroperating more automatically and being more resistant to logical arguments (e.g., “Thesoul continues to exist though the body may die”).

In line with our argument that superstitions are based on early intuitions, previous stud-ies have shown that superstitions are more strongly related to a tendency to rely on intui-tive thinking than to analytical thinking (Aarnio & Lindeman, 2005; Epstein, Pacini, DenesRaj, & Heier, 1996; Wolfradt, Oubaid, Straube, BischoV, & Mischo, 1999), and that thesame magical beliefs that are typical to preschool children are implicitly preserved andactivated among adults even though the representations have been devaluated in the faceof more rational knowledge (Subbotsky, 2000, 2001).

To investigate whether the new conceptualization is warranted, we hypothesized that incomparison to skeptical individuals, superstitious individuals more often assign mental attri-butes to physical and biological entities and material attributes to mental entities, and con-fuse intentional processes with non-intentional processes. We also hypothesized that varioustypes of superstitious, magical, and paranormal beliefs are similarly related to ontologicalconfusions and that the ontological confusions are positively related to a tendency to rely onintuitive thinking. Finally, we expected that ontological confusions and intuitive thinking aremore important correlates of superstitions, magical and paranormal beliefs than two othercorrelates that have repeatedly been suggested to account for the beliefs, namely low rationalthinking and emotional instability (reviews: Vyse, 1997; Zusne & Jones, 1989).

2. Method

2.1. Participants

Two hundred and thirty-nine Finnish volunteers participated in the study: 96 femaleskeptics, 27 male skeptics, 88 female, and 28 male superstitious individuals. Their age rangewas 16–47 with a mean of 24.2 years. The great majority (94%) were full-time students whorepresented a wide variety of disciplines, including the natural, behavioural, medical, andsocial sciences, technique, business and trade, and services.

2.2. Procedure

The participants were recruited from a larger population (ND 3261) of participants in astudy on superstition, which was conducted one year earlier. We sent an invitation to those

whose overall superstition scores (see Section 2.3) were among the upper or lower 10% fortheir gender. The groups were balanced for gender because in the earlier study, women(MD2.16) had higher superstition scores than men (MD1.94), F (1, 3245)D 106.44,p < .001, �2D .032. The recruitment message contained a personal password and a hyper-link to the questionnaire on the Internet. The web survey was implemented as a Java Serv-let, running on an Apache web server. Due to incomplete contact information, a total of14% of the participants of the earlier study were eventually invited to take part. Fifty-threepercent of them returned a completed questionnaire within the time limit.

2.3. Measures

2.3.1. Ontological confusionsWe constructed measures of ontological confusion by utilizing Chi and her associates’

(Chi, 1992; Chi, Slotta, & de Leeuw, 1994) conceptualizations and assessment methods ofontological categories and their distinctions.

First, we examined the participants’ conceptions of properties of diVerent ontologicalentities by 34 statements in which attributes of one ontological category were assigned toanother one. The participants were asked whether they understood the statements as meta-phorically or literally true (1Donly metaphorically; 5Donly literally).

In 16 of the statements, material entities (artifacts, liquids, solids, and plants) held men-tal attributes (e.g., beliefs, desires, and kindness). Example statements include: “Old furni-ture know things about the past” and “When summer is warm, Xowers want to bloom.”These items constituted the measure of mentalizing matter (�D .94). Ten of the statementsassessed physicalizing mental (�D .88) and they described mental phenomena (a thought, ahuman mind) with attributes of physical matter (e.g., has volume, aVects a material entity ifit touches it). Example statements include “An unstable human mind is disintegrating.” Sixstatements assessed biologizing mental (�D .84) and they described mental phenomena (athought, a human mind) with attributes of biological entities (e.g., is living, can be contam-inated), for example, “An evil thought is contaminated.” For comparison, there were alsoeight fully metaphorical statements (e.g., “A wailing wind is a Xute”; �D .88) and four fullyliteral statements (e.g., “Running water is Xuid”; �D .86).

Confusion between intentional and non-intentional events was analyzed by giving theparticipants descriptions of 18 non-intentional events that lead to personally relevant out-comes, and by asking whether they saw purpose in that event (1D the event had no purpose,5D the event clearly had a purpose). Following the work of Chi and her associates (Chi,1992; Chi et al., 1994), the 18 statements included three types of non-intentional events. Sixof the events were random (e.g., dealing cards in a card game), six were artiWcial (e.g., aserver failure), and six were natural events (e.g., fog). For each set of six events, positive,negative, and neutral outcomes were described. The positive and negative outcomes werederived from the Life Experience Survey (Sarason, Johnson, & Siegel, 1978). An examplestatement of a random event with a negative outcome is: “You play cards but get onlyclubs and spades and therefore run into large debts. Was there a purpose in getting thosecards?” An example statement of an artiWcial event with a positive outcome includes: “Thebrakes of your car fail and you smash up with a stranger whom you will later marry. Didthe brakes fail for a purpose?” An example statement of natural events with a neutral out-come is: “A lightning cuts down a big tree in the garden of your house but no harm isbrought to you by this. Did the lightning have a purpose?” Sum scales of the statements

dealing with random (�D .92), artiWcial (�D .93), and natural events (�D .94) were con-structed by averaging the items.

For comparison, there were also four statements, which described true intentionalevents (e.g., a kiss, running race, and bullying) with positive, neutral, and negative out-comes (e.g., a beginning of a romantic relationship, reduced working ability). However, thereliability of this scale was low (�D .53), possibly because the participants consistentlyassessed intentional events with positive outcomes to be more purposeful than the otherevents, F (1, 238)D343.25, p < .001.

Also, a total score for ontological confusions was calculated by averaging all the relateditems. The reliability (�) was .92.

2.3.2. BeliefsInformation on participants’ beliefs (and on intuitive and analytical thinking, and emo-

tional instability) was acquired in an earlier study. Most beliefs were measured with theRevised Paranormal Belief Scale (Tobacyk, 2004), which is a slightly revised version of themost commonly used measure of superstitious, magical, paranormal, and religious beliefs(Tobacyk & Milford, 1983). Because the items on the RPBS cover only some aspects ofsuperstitious and magical beliefs, it was supplemented with a number of items to cover awider spectrum of beliefs. The 55 items were measured on a Wve-point rating scale(1D strongly disagree, 5D strongly agree).

Belief in paranormal agents (�D .83) was measured with 14 items on belief in witches,extraordinary life forms, and extraterrestrial life (e.g., “Ghosts exist”). Belief in the para-normal abilities of human beings (�D .83) was assessed with 10 items focusing on beliefs intelepathy, spiritualism, precognition, and psychokinesis (e.g., “A person’s thoughts caninXuence the movement of a physical object”). Religious beliefs (�D .88) was gauged by the4 items in RPBS (e.g., “I believe in God”). Luck beliefs (�D .83) were measured with 9 state-ments about omens of luck, rituals, and amulets (e.g., “Amulets, for instance a speciWcpiece of jewelry, bring good luck”). Belief in astrology (�D .89) was operationalized withWve items (e.g., “The position of the stars at the time of birth inXuences personality”). Beliefin the claims of feng shui (�D .89) was measured with Wve items (e.g., “Furnishing accord-ing to the principles of feng shui balances your environment and thus aVects your healthand success in a positive way”). In addition, a mean score of all the items was used to mea-sure overall superstition (�D .96).

Analytical and intuitive thinking were assessed by the Rational-Experiential Inventory(Pacini & Epstein, 1999). The inventory consists of two 20-item scales (1D strongly dis-agree, 5D strongly agree). The Rationality subscale (�D .87) assesses the extent to which anindividual engages in and enjoys rational, analytic, eVortful, aVect-free, and logical think-ing. The Experientiality subscale (�D .88) assesses the extent to which an individualengages in and enjoys automatic, preconscious, holistic, non-verbal, and associationisticthinking. Example items include: “I usually have clear, explainable reasons for my deci-sions” (analytical or rational thinking) and “I believe in trusting my hunches” (experientialor intuitive thinking).

Emotional instability was measured by the Neuroticism subscale of the Finnish versionof the NEO Five-Factor Inventory (McCrae & Costa, 1987; Pulver, Allik, Pulkkinen, &Hamalainen, 1995). The subscale consists of 48 Wve-point items (1D strongly disagree,5D strongly agree), which measure anxiety, depression, self-consciousness, vulnerability,impulsiveness, and hostility. The reliability (�) of the scale was .93.

3. Results

The results showed that, as hypothesized, the believers mentalized matter more (MD2.30)than the skeptics (MD1.88), F (1,237)D16.66, p<.001, �2D .07, they physicalized mental more(MD2.84) than the skeptics (MD2.34), F (1,237)D26.44, p<.001, �2D .10, and they biologizedmental more (MD2.68) than the skeptics (MD2.01), F (1,237)D34.07, p<.001, �2D .13. Thebelievers did not diVer from the skeptics when they assessed the truth of purely literal state-ments, F (1,237)D0.15, ns, or the purely metaphorical statements, F (1,237)D1.18, ns.

In addition, the believers also assigned more (MD2.82) purpose to natural events thanthe skeptics (MD 1.24), F (1,235)D 197.49, p < .001, �2D .46; more (MD 2.75) purpose toartiWcial events than the skeptics (MD 1.28), F (1, 235)D169.53, p < .001, �2D .42; and more(MD3.00) purpose to random events than the skeptics (MD1.40), F (1, 235)D 200.62,p < .001, �2D .46. The purpose of intentional events was assessed equally by the believersand the skeptics, F (1, 237)D1.57, ns.

The results also showed that the believers relied more on intuitive thinking (MD3.69) thanthe skeptics (MD2.99), F (1,239)D97.51, p <.001, �2D .29; but less on analytical thinking(MD3.78) than the skeptics (MD4.05), F (1,239)D14.50, p< .001, �2D .06; and that theywere emotionally less stable (MD2.62) than the skeptics (MD2.86), F (1,239)D9.68, p < .01,�2D .04. No gender diVerences were found between the groups, �2 (1)D0.16, ns. This is intelli-gible, because the participants were selected from individuals whose overall superstitionscores in the earlier study were among the upper or lower 10% for their gender.

To analyze how the ontological confusions relate to various types of beliefs, intuitive andanalytical thinking, and emotional instability, correlations were obtained. Because only skep-tics and believers were included in the sample, the originally continuous belief variables werenot normally but bimodally distributed. Therefore, Spearman’s rho, which transforms ratiolevel variables into rank-orders and thus linearizes the relationship, was used (Table 1).

To Wnd the best function that separates believers and skeptics, and to compare theimportance of the predictors of group membership, a standard discriminant function anal-ysis was performed using the total score of ontological confusions, intuitive and analyticalthinking, and emotional instability as predictors of group membership. One discriminantfunction was calculated, with a �2 (4)D168.69, p < .001 (Table 2). The loading matrix ofcorrelations between predictors and the discriminant function suggests that the best pre-dictor for distinguishing between superstitious and skeptics were ontological confusions,followed by intuitive thinking. Other predictors were not important because, by conven-tion, correlations lower than .33 are not considered eligible (Tabachnick & Fidell, 1996).

The loadings reveal only the full correlation between the discriminant function and thepredictors, and the variance shared with ontological confusions and group membershipmay thus be predictable from other predictors. The structure coeYcients, in turn, show theunique contribution the predictors make. As can be seen from Table 2, after adjustment forother predictors, ontological confusions are still the most important predictors of being askeptic or a believer.

4. Discussion

Historically, researchers have considered beliefs in superstition, magic, and the paranor-mal in some indeWnite way both as distinct and interrelated phenomena. Also, the deWni-tions of the concepts have repeatedly been insuYcient. The present study oVered a uniWedconceptual framework where the concepts were diVerentiated from other unfoundedbeliefs and deWned identically as an ontological confusion between the core attributes ofmental, physical, and biological entities and processes. In addition, we examined whethersuperstitious individuals confuse the attributes of ontological categories, as the deWnitionsuggests.

The results gave justiWcation for the deWnition. Compared with the skeptics, the super-stitious individuals assigned more physical and biological attributes to mental phenomena.Thus, they understood such notions as a mind that can touch objects and an evil thoughtthat may be contaminated more literally than the skeptics. Superstitious individuals alsoassigned more mental attributes to water, furniture, rocks, and other material things thanskeptics did and accepted that entities like these may—literally, not only metaphorically—have psychological properties such as desires, knowledge, or a soul. In particular, supersti-tious individuals saw natural, random and artiWcial (i.e., non-intentional) events like fog ora server failure as having a purpose when the processes had led to episodes with a person-ally relevant outcome such as a marriage. The believers did not, however, diVer from theskeptics when they assessed the literal truth of purely literal or purely metaphorical state-ments, or the purposefulness of truly intentional acts like kissing.

The results also showed that various manifestations of the beliefs, for example beliefs inastrology, feng shui and paranormal abilities of human beings, were associated with onto-logical confusions and with higher intuitive thinking, and—albeit only slightly—to loweranalytical thinking and emotional instability. Because the believer and skeptic groups werebeforehand balanced for gender, the eVect of gender was not analyzed. However, it shouldbe noted that women’s lower analytical and higher intuitive thinking have been shown tobe the generative mechanisms for women’s higher endorsement of paranormal beliefs com-pared to men (Aarnio & Lindeman, 2005).

The discriminant analysis indicated that the best measures to distinguish believers fromskeptics were ontological confusions, and secondarily intuitive thinking. Neither analyticalthinking nor emotional stability could discriminate the groups from each other. Theseresults support the argument that superstitions and other paranormal beliefs arise from theintuitive system and not from a malfunctioning analytical system and are in line with theearlier Wndings that people who rely more on intuitive thinking hold more superstitionsthan others (Epstein et al., 1996; Wolfradt et al., 1999). When assessing the importance ofthe measures’ unique contribution, after variance associated with other predictors hadbeen removed, susceptibility to ontological confusions remained the most important pre-dictor of group membership. As a whole, then, the results are in line with the notion thatontological confusions are deWning properties of superstitions, magical, and paranormalbeliefs.

The new deWnition of superstition has evident beneWts compared with the earlier deWni-tions. For one thing, some of the earlier deWnitions have been too wide in that superstitionshave been regarded equal to any unsupported notion. By pointing out the category mistakeof core knowledge, the present deWnition enables us to identify how superstitions diVerfrom other unfounded beliefs. Accordingly, many beliefs that have previously beenregarded as paranormal, magical, or superstitious are simply unsubstantiated beliefs, notsuperstitions. These include, for example, belief in graphology or biorhythms. Likewise,beliefs obeying the laws of contagion and similarity are here regarded as superstitions onlyinsofar as the idea of contagion is stretched beyond the biological domain and similarity isused to draw inferences about entities from diVerent ontological domains. Thus, disgusttowards a piece of clothing worn by a sick person is not a superstition whereas disgusttowards clothes worn by Hitler is. Similarly, reasoning that whales are Wsh because of simi-lar appearance and habitats is simply a false belief whereas a belief that needles stuck in adoll cause pain in the person the doll represents is a superstition.

On the other hand, so far no deWnition has been wide enough to cover all types of super-stitions, magical and paranormal beliefs. The present deWnition, in contrast, makes it possi-ble to understand that the beliefs can manifest itself in endless ways. They can range fromprimeval animism to the trendy (albeit ancient) idea that furniture and buildings have liv-ing energy, from children’s beliefs that the moon is an animate being to educated adults’beliefs in astrology, and from animate paintings in Harry Potter’s milieu to the magicalideas about contamination and external forces found among patients suVering from obses-sive-compulsive disorder and schizophrenia. We suggest that confusion of core knowledgeis the common denominator for all these, and that the prevailing culture as well as believ-ers’ explicit knowledge and other mental resources shape the more speciWc contents andmanifestations of the beliefs.

In our view, the new conceptualization enables researchers to make more elaboratedtheoretical statements regarding superstition. So far, theoretical arguments have lacked

statements speciWc to superstitions. For example, one of the main reasons for the existenceof superstitions has traditionally been taken to be people’s search for causal explanationsand organizing the world in a meaningful and consistent fashion to impose order and pre-dictability on it (Malinowski, 1948/1992; Tambiah, 1990). However, because the same rea-sons also apply to numerous other endeavors, such as scientiWc work, the explanatorypower of these statements for superstition has been weak.

The present study suggests that future theory formation and studies on superstitionmight beneWt from addressing intuitive thinking and its knowledge base. SubsequenteVorts may provide more powerful indications that superstitious individuals’ knowledgeabout the world is inaccurate in that their early, as yet undeveloped intuitive conceptionsabout psychological, biological, and physical phenomena have retained their autonomouspower and co-exist side by side with later acquired rational knowledge. While the role ofinsuYcient or incorrect knowledge in superstitions has been acknowledged for long (Mali-nowski, 1948/1992; Piaget, 1929/1951), it is surprising that so far no research attention hasbeen paid to superstitious individuals’ knowledge about entities and processes in the world.In short, whereas developmental psychology research has focused on the strength of coreknowledge among children, research on superstition would beneWt from studies thataddress the vulnerabilities of this knowledge among adults.

In addition, future research might attempt to analyze whether superstitions can beunderstood in terms of a common essence. There is increasing evidence that children’s con-ception about what unites members of the same category (e.g., dogs and cats) and whatdiVerentiates members of one category from another (e.g., toys and dogs) is based on thenotion of an essence (Gelman, 2004; Johnson & Harris, 1994). Similarly, Meigs (1984) hassuggested that a central theme in the versatile magical beliefs found among the Hua peoplein New Guinea is a common, vital essence, nu. This common essence parallels the view thatin superstitions, there is typically an interconnected cosmos, a fundamental relationbetween a part and a whole, a human being and a universe, and a single event and thefuture (Malinowski, 1948/1992; Piaget, 1929/1951; Werner, 1948). Hence, it might behypothesized that confusion between the core properties of ontological categories implies anotion of a common essence between the categories and thus leads to thinking in terms ofconnections and undivided totalities.

In many ways, the results are only preliminary. Most importantly, ontological confu-sions should be examined much more thoroughly in future studies. In addition, only verb-alizable conceptions about the ontological categories of physical, biological, and mentalphenomena were examined. Although the results showed that at least part of these concep-tions are explicit and can be tapped with a questionnaire, our assumption is that majorityof this knowledge is outside of conscious awareness, and are thus held at diVerent levels ofexplicitness, ranging from spontaneous and indistinct “as if” feelings to explicit beliefs(NemeroV & Rozin, 2000; Subbotsky, 2001). Therefore, in future studies, ontological con-ceptions should be examined with research methods focusing on implicit knowledge.

Moreover, only believers and skeptics were included in the study. We focused onextreme groups because we were concerned about the possibility that the middle groupconsists of habitual believers, that is, of individuals who actually do not believe in supersti-tions but take them as entertainment, or as Vyse (1997) have suggested, as habits that helppass the time. If this were the case, the middle group would be qualitatively diVerent thanthe extreme groups. However, this is only speculation, and the results need replicationon samples more representative of the general population. Finally, while the use of

correlational design is justiWed in research in its initial stages, future development of thepropositions will require experimental designs.

Despite these limitations, we have provided a conceptual framework that integrates theexisting heterogeneous deWnitions, links prior and present Wndings to theory, and opensavenues for future studies on the enchantment of superstition, magic, and the paranormal.What has been established is an initial understanding that it may be a question of vaguecategory boundaries, as Woody Allen (1980, p. 15) already has found out: “There is noquestion that there is an unseen world. The problem is how far it is from midtown and howlate is it open?”
